Fake Palm Jaggery Crackdown

Activists in Thoothukudi, Tamil Nadu are renewing their call for a crackdown on fake palm jaggery products, which are being sold with lower GST rates by mixing with sugar, the activists are demanding authorities to take strict action against sellers of these products to protect consumers and genuine manufacturers, the issue is related to GST tariffs as packed palm jaggery attracts 5% GST while sugar-blended jaggery attracts 18% GST
